CSS布局是网页html经过div标签+css款式表代码开垦制做的(html)网页的统称。
CSSfloat属性float浮动属性,用于配置标签目标(如:div、span、a、em等html标签)的浮动布局,浮动也即是咱们所说标签目标浮动居左靠左(float:left)和浮动居右靠右(float:right)。
float的影响:经过css界说float(浮动)让div款式层块,向左或向右(靠)浮动。
配置模块向左浮动:
.box{float:left;}
float语法:float:none
left
right
inherit,离别是目标不浮动、浮在左边、浮在右边、从父元素承担。
CSSclear属性clear属性规则元素的哪一侧不答应其余浮动元素。
clear属性界说了元素的哪边上不答应呈现浮动元素。在CSS1和CSS2中,这是经过主动为断根元素(即配置了clear属性的元素)增多上外边距完结的。在CSS2.1中,会在元素上外边距之上增多断根空间,而外边距自身并不变动。不管哪一种变动,最后了局都同样,要是说明为左边或右边断根,会使元素的上外边框边境恰幸而该边上浮动元素的下外边距边境之下。
图象的左边和右边均不答应呈现浮动元素:
img{float:left;clear:both;}
clear语法:clear:none
left
right
both。对应参数值为:答应双方均能够有浮动目标、不答应左边有浮动目标、不答应右边有浮动目标、不答应有浮动目标
咱们屡屡用于应用了floatcss款式后形成浮动,最罕用是应用clear:both断根浮动。比方一个大目标内有2个小目标应用了cssfloat款式为了防止形成浮动,大目标后台或边框不能无误显示,这个时间咱们就需求clear:both断根浮动。
CSSoverflow属性overflow属性规则当体例溢出元素框时产生的事项。
这个属性界说溢出元素体例区的体例会怎样管教。要是值为scroll,不管是不是需求,用户代办都邑供应一种震动机制。是以,有或许纵使元素框中能够放下整个体例也会呈现震动条。
配置overflow属性:
div{width:px;height:px;overflow:scroll;}
overflow语法:overflow:
visible
auto
hidden
scroll
visible:不剪切体例也不增加震动条。假设显式说明此默许值,目标将被剪切为包括目标的window或frame的巨细。而且clip属性配置将做废auto:此为body目标和textarea的默许值。在需求时剪切体例并增加震动条,DIV默许状况也是这个值,但需求配置时间配置便可hidden:不显示超出目标尺寸的体例scroll:老是显示震动条
overflow能够独自配置X(overflow-x)和Y(overflow-y)方位的震动条款式其值与运用与overflow语法用法机关雷同
div{width:px;height:px;overflow-x:hidden;}CSSdisplay属性
display属性规则元素理当生成的框的典型。
这个属性用于界说创立布局时元素生成的显示框典型。关于HTML等文档典型,要是应用display不束缚会很危险,由于或许违背HTML中曾经界说的显示条理机关。关于XML,由于XML没有内置的这类条理机关,整个display是绝对须要的。
使段落生出行内框:
p.inline{display:inline;}
语法:display:block
none
inline